In the Internet of Things (IoT), efficient and reliable data communication is the backbone of smooth operations. Since its inception in 1999, MQTT (Message Queuing Telemetry Transport) has been a central protocol in achieving this, especially noted for its lightweight nature and minimal bandwidth usage. Originally designed to monitor oil pipelines, MQTT has evolved considerably, with its latest iteration, MQTT 5, introducing major enhancements that further solidify its role in the IoT network.

## The Evolution of MQTT and Its Impact on IoT

MQTT's journey from a niche protocol to a cornerstone of IoT communications reflects its adaptability and efficiency. The introduction of MQTT 5 marks a significant milestone, offering advanced features that cater to the growing demands of IoT applications. We explore the seven critical enhancements of MQTT 5 and how they impact IoT communications.

### 1\. Advanced Message Control

MQTT 5 brings superior message control capabilities, such as topic aliasing and improved message flow control. These advancements lead to more efficient data transmission, reducing network load and improving communication efficiency.

### 2\. Improved Feedback and Error Reporting

The protocol offers enhanced feedback and error-reporting mechanisms, including new response codes and reason strings. This improvement provides immediate insights into message statuses and enables quick identification of communication issues, which makes troubleshooting faster.

### 3\. Simplified Request/Response Pattern

With a built-in Request/Response mechanism, MQTT 5 simplifies interactions across IoT systems. This feature enables direct information exchange between devices and brokers, making the development process more efficient and improving synchronous communication.

### 4\. Performance Enhancements

MQTT 5 introduces performance improvements through reduced packet sizes and transport layer optimization. These enhancements lead to faster message delivery and reduced latency, boosting communication efficiency within the IoT infrastructure.

### 5\. User and Message Properties

This feature allows for custom metadata in messages, offering a personalized and context-rich data exchange. User Properties enable attaching user-specific information, adding a layer of customization to the communication process.

### 6\. Payload Format and Content-Type Specification

By allowing for the explicit definition of message payload formats and content types, MQTT 5 ensures consistent data representation and easier processing by devices and applications. This standardization enhances the clarity and efficiency of data exchange.

### 7\. Enhanced Authentication

MQTT 5 improves the security of IoT deployments with advanced authentication mechanisms, including TLS/SSL certificates, token-based authentication, and OAuth 2.0 support. These features ensure secure device-to-device and device-to-server communications.
